Etsy has scheduled a virtual meeting on August 5, providing investors with an opportunity to engage with company updates and strategic initiatives. The e-commerce giant operates a top-10 marketplace in the US and UK, with significant operations in Germany, France, Australia, and Canada. Etsy generates revenue through listing fees, commissions, advertising, payment processing, and shipping labels, with a market capitalization of $5.78 billion [3].

During the second quarter of 2025, Etsy reported earnings of 25 cents per share, missing the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 53.7% and decreasing 39% year over year. Revenues increased 3.8% year over year to $672.7 million, with strong on-site advertising performance driving the growth [2]. Etsy's stock has climbed 17.1% year to date, outperforming the Zacks Retail and Wholesale sector's 6% return [2].

Melissa Reiff, Etsy's Director, sold 6,909 shares of Common Stock on August 1, 2025, at a weighted average price of $58.89 per share, totaling $406,871. Following this transaction, Reiff directly owns 16,424 shares of Etsy [1].

Etsy's balance sheet shows cash and cash equivalents of $1.2 billion, an increase from $649.2 million as of March 31, 2025. Long-term debt was $3 billion at the end of the second quarter, up from $2.3 billion reported at the end of the prior quarter [2].

For the third quarter of 2025, Etsy anticipates the take rate to be 24.5% and consolidated GMS to be between $2.6 billion and $2.7 billion. The adjusted EBITDA margin is expected to be 25% [2].
